Cabinet Bottom Panel - charliepickles - 05-07-2026 Hi I have a base cabinet that is 24" wide and 18" deep using 3/4 plywood which is being assembled with pocket hole screws. When calculate the panel cutlist the bottom panel is 23 1/4 x 17 1/2. The depth of the panel is correct at 17 1/2 but the width should be 22. I set any dado setting to 0 but I must be missing another setting somewhere. I typically build my face frame 24" wide which extends 1/4 beyond the cabinet on both sides. So the interior dimension of the bottom panel would be 22x17 1/4, but the dimension I see in my cutlist is 23 1/4 x 17 1/4. Am I missing a setting or should I be doing something differently? Thanks RE: Cabinet Bottom Panel - admin - 05-07-2026 "I typically build my face frame 24" wide which extends 1/4 beyond the cabinet on both sides." Use the scribe settings to get the face frame to extend beyond the side of the box. This shortens the box width by the total entered for the left & right. If you always do this you can set the scribe defaults in the general standards. If the dado depth was not set to zero in the standards when you created the cabinet, the cabinet still carries the non zero value. open the editing window for the cabinet and press the MORE button. you can change that cabinet's dado depth there.
